WebLet’s say you have a pay per mile policy with a base price of $29 per month, plus a 6¢ per-mile price. If you’re behind the wheel as much as the average American driver, you would pay about $72 for your mileage each month, in addition to that $29 base price, which comes out to $101 for a month of car insurance.
